Naked Lunch Script (NL#3) [J:531]
Hand-marked NL with 3 in circle. Orange folder with hand-written NL and 3 in circle. Contains typed script of Naked Lunch circa 1972, with corrections, 123 pp. Marked on page 1, top: Return to: Anthony Balch Films.
Naked Lunch Script Correspondence (NL#4) [J:531]
Hand-marked with NL & 4 in circle. Maroon colored folder with hand-written NL4 circled. On front cover is hand-written note: material relative to Naked Lunch film script, to films in general. Correspondence with Brion Gysin reference to N.L. film,
1970-71. Includes corrected typescript, The Blue Movies,
29 pp. Also: Bill's notes.
Naked Lunch Script Agreements (NL#8) [J:531]
Hand-marked 8 in circle. Orange colored folder with yellow label marked Naked Lunch
film papers. Hand-written N.L. Film Papers.
Folder contains: rough draft of Agreement
between William W. Burroughs and Brion Gysin; and copy of signed Agreement.
Naked Lunch Script [J:531]
Envelope addressed to Brion Gysin in Tangier from New York. Contains Naked Lunch Script early version. Scenes 54-367.
Naked Lunch Script by Don Sanders [J:531], 1970
Blue legal-size letter wallet containing Script by Don Sanders for Naked Lunch state production in Chicago, 1970., and letter to Burroughs from Sanders.
